I hate flouro I tried em all and the same results
Broke line
Memory
Crappy Casting
I have opted to use lighter mono and had good results I use suffix exclusively
8lbs siege on spinning gear
12lbs deep crankin on my CB rods
14lbs elite on all my others except my jig and grass rods I use 65lbs 832 braid with a 20lbs elite leader in clear water and straight braid in stained

I changed my knot 2-3 years ago and have not had a problem since. If I break off it is because I get lazy and do not retie.....and the only way to possibly avoid that is to use braid. I believe it's advantages far outweigh the negatives if any. I caught 4 fish between 3-5 lbs in a row last Saturday all on the same knot and even got wrapped up in the timber a few times. There was no visual damage to my line and I probably could have left it alone but retied anyways for peace of mind. I have had that same line spooled on my Revo since October '12 which is 2 months longer than I usually leave it on for. Seaguar Red Label 15 lb test is what I was using on a dropshot.

All good points. Lived in San Angelo in the late 90's and spent many a days bobbing around on OH Ivie. Caught a lot of big fish out of that lake 5 or so over 10 lbs and never spooled a single reel with flouro. Horsed em out of bushes and trees, caught em in 30ft of water off deep points with c-rigs and cranks, and pretty much fished everything with 15lb 20lb and 25lb Big Game. I did use a flouro leader when I figured out what it was but that was the extent of it. Cant imagine in my head how much money I have spent in the last 2-3 years on flouro spools. Downright silly!
